Unlocking Your Potential: The Salary Landscape for Social Media Managers
The thriving world of social media presents a rewarding landscape for aspiring professionals. As a skilled social media manager, your ability to generate compelling content and interact with audiences can translate into a lucrative salary.
Factors such as experience, geographic region, and industry can substantially influence your earning potential. With the growing demand for social media specialists, now is an ideal time to delve into this captivating career path.
ul
li The average salary for a social media manager can range from $40,000 to over $80,000 per year.
li Compensation can be even higher for expert managers with proven track records of success.
ul
By honing your skills and staying up-to-date with the latest trends, you can maximize your earning potential and achieve career goals.
Your Ultimate Resource to Building a Full-Fledged Social Media Presence
Launching successfully on social media requires more than just sharing random updates. You need a well-planned setup that enables growth and engagement.
- First, identify your core demographic. Who are you trying to connect with? Understanding their interests is vital for creating content they'll find valuable.
- , Following this, select the right platforms for your brand. Don't try to do everything at once. Focus on where your core demographic engages frequently.
- Finally, develop a consistent brand presence across all platforms. Use attractive visuals, craft captivating content, and interact with your followers.

Key Resources Every Social Media Manager Needs
To dominate the ever-changing world of social media, a savvy manager needs more than just creative flair. A solid toolkit of applications is crucial for optimizing your workflow and driving engagement. From planning posts to tracking performance, the right tools can make all the difference.
- Reporting Suites like Google Analytics or SproutSocial give you invaluable metrics into your audience and campaign success.
- Content creation tools such as Canva or Buffer's built-in editor help you craft eye-catching visuals and captivating content.
- Platform Suites like Hootsuite or Later allow you to schedule posts across multiple platforms with ease.
Investing the right tools can free up your time, allowing you to focus on building relationships and ultimately reach your social media goals.
